Resona Holdings Inc. (OTC: RSNHF) is a prominent financial services group based in Japan, primarily engaged in banking, asset management, and other financial services. Established in 2001 and headquartered in Tokyo, Resona has grown to become one of Japan's significant banking institutions, operating through its main subsidiaries, Resona Bank, Saitama Resona Bank, and Kansai Mirai Financial Group.
The organization focuses on retail banking services, including deposit-taking, loans, and consulting services, aimed at individuals and small to med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). Resona Holdings is one of the top six Japanese banking groups by assets. Although its banking units are categorized in Japan as "city" banks for historical reasons, it is only around a third of the size of the three megabank groups and effectively a super-regional bank operating mainly in the Kansai region (54% of its branches) and the Tokyo metropolitan area (43% of branches), with a strong focus on retail and small and medium-size enterprises, rather than lending to large corporates. Its overseas operations are limited, which allows it to operate in compliance with domestic capital standards alone.
